假设我知道git-daemon在git://git.mycompany.com上运行,我如何列出由该特定实例提供的所有存储库?
更新:我没有shell访问git.mycompany.com的权限。
发布于 2009-06-27 09:33:28
还有一种方法,但它需要一些帮助,你们公司服务器管理员。git的特点是一个名为'GitWeb‘的可浏览web前端,它可以配置为显示Git服务的所有项目。
详细信息在GitWeb自述中解释--感兴趣的配置键称为"GITWEB_PROJECTROOT":
GITWEB_PROJECTROOT是gitweb显示的所有项目的根目录。必须正确设置gitweb才能找到要显示的存储库。还请参阅gitweb安装文件中的"Gitweb存储库“。
也许你可以和你的管理员谈一谈-- gitweb对所有的开发人员来说都是一笔巨大的利润。
发布于 2009-06-23 04:12:19
据我所知,这需要在运行git-daemon的机器上完成。您需要检查调用git-daemon的参数,或者可能检查/etc/inetd.conf。
https://stackoverflow.com/questions/1029514
复制相似问题